Hey guys,
I am following http://www.ovirt.org/Local_Jenkins_For_The_People in order to set up a build env for ovirt-engine. I've got the basic setup running but I'd like to be able to build rpms in the same way that we do on oVirt.org. I came across the 'jenkins' repo in gerrit but I can't figure out how to use that to create an XML file for the create_rpms job suitable for import into jenkins. Can anyone point me in the right direction?
